How to Actually Win (or at Least Not Lose Too Fast)
Let me be honest. Roulette is a game of luck. No strategy can beat the house edge in the long run. But you can manage your money so the session lasts longer. That is the real skill.
- Stick to European Roulette. The American wheel has a double zero. That doubles the house edge to 5.26%. The European wheel has a single zero. The house edge is 2.7%. It is a no-brainer.
- Avoid the ‘Five Number’ bet. On the American wheel, the bet on 0, 00, 1, 2, and 3 has a house edge of 7.89%. It is a sucker bet. Do not take it.
- Use the ‘En Prison’ rule if available. Some French roulette tables offer this. If the ball lands on zero, your even-money bet is locked for the next spin. It reduces the house edge to 1.35%. That is the best deal you can get.
- Set a loss limit. Decide how much you are willing to lose before you start. For me, it is £50. Once I lose that, I walk away. Do not chase losses. The wheel does not care about your feelings.

The UK market is regulated. That is good. It means the games are fair. The Random Number Generators (RNGs) are tested by eCOGRA or iTech Labs. The U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) is strict. If a casino cheats, they lose their license.
But here is the catch. The UKGC also restricts certain bonuses. You cannot get a ‘no wagering’ bonus easily. Most offers have a 35x or 40x wagering requirement. That means if you get a £100 bonus, you need to bet £3,500 before you can withdraw any winnings. It is annoying. But it is the law.

What is the minimum bet for online roulette in the UK?
It varies. Some sites allow bets as low as £0.10 per spin on the RNG version. Live dealer tables usually start at £1 or £5. High roller tables can go up to £10,000 per spin.
Are online roulette games rigged?
On a UKGC licensed site, no. The RNG is tested. The house edge is built into the game design. It is not rigged. It is just math. The casino has a 2.7% advantage on European roulette. Over time, they will win. But in the short term, you can get lucky.
How fast are withdrawals from UK roulette sites?
Most e-wallet withdrawals (PayPal, Skrill, Neteller) are processed within 24 hours. Bank transfers can take 2-5 days. Debit card withdrawals (Visa, Mastercard) usually take 1-3 days. Some sites like Casumo process withdrawals in under an hour for e-wallets.
